Batty Advances to Finals
DES MOINES, Iowa -- Junior Miles Batty advanced to the finals of the 1,500 meters as BYU’s only competitor on day two of the NCAA Outdoor Track and Field Championships.
The Sandy native clocked a time of 3:42.84 in his qualifying heat, finishing second to move on. Batty will compete in the finals of the 1,500 meters on
Saturday at approximately 11:30 a.m. MT. Fans can watch live on CBS.
Friday’s competition will begin at 2 p.m. MT. Senior Leif Arrhenius will see action in his second event, the shot put, as well as senior Trevor Heiner competing in the high jump.
